0 / 0 / 0
Регистрация: 29.04.2007
Сообщений: 66

Задача по формам в Access(?)

21.05.2007, 01:03. Показов 641. Ответов 2
Метки нет (Все метки)

Студворк — интернет-сервис помощи студентам
Привет!

Задача вот:
Создать две формы.
Первая форма будет добавлять новую запись в таблицу с двумя полями: код
станции(ключ. поле) и значения восьми показателей(целые числа от 1 до 7,
хранимые в виде одного 8 - разрядного числа). Вторая для демонстрации данных
по одной записи(запрет изменения данных, каждый из показателей вывести в
отдельном поле). В этой же таблице реализовать возможность вычисления суммы,
среднего, максимума и минимума по показателям данной записи.

Первый раз делаю, такого рода задачу. Не могу себе представить, как будет
выглядеть моя работа.
Первую форму я сделал, проверил на корректность ввода. А вот со второй
формой проблема. Как она будет связана с первой? А может сделать подчинённую
форму. Но как, если поля с показателями не являются фактическими полями
таблицы? Или я совсем не на том зациклился... Помогите пожалуйста.
0
Programming
Эксперт
39485 / 9562 / 3019
Регистрация: 12.04.2006
Сообщений: 41,671
Блог
21.05.2007, 01:03
Ответы с готовыми решениями:

Задача по формам в Access(?)
Привет! Задача вот: Создать две формы. Первая форма будет добавлять новую запись в таблицу с двумя полями: код станции(ключ....

Задача по формам Pascal ABC
Помогите пожалуйста сделать задачку с формами. Вводится в форму число в 10 системе счисления на выводе получается 2,8,16 система счисления....

Как подключить одну таблицу базу данных MS Access к двум формам windows?
Проблема заключается в том что не понимаю,как подключить через кнопку базу данных. namespace Students { public partial class...

2
0 / 0 / 0
Регистрация: 18.05.2007
Сообщений: 25
21.05.2007, 08:10
выйди в схему данных добавь туда обе таблицы
зделай связь, но учти уникальные записи должны
быть в обоих таблицах, и свяжи их по полям
да и обратись к справке она в ACCESS очень подробная
0
Mavr
21.05.2007, 08:28
Делай две формы у которых свойство RecordSource(Источник записей по русски) будет одинаковым RecordSource=Имя твоей таблицы (например Table1)
или что-нибудь такое
RecordSource=SELECT * From Table1
В общем надо что бы твой первичный ключ включался в источник записей и для одной и для другой формы.
Дальше можно сделать двумя способами какой больше понравится.
1. На главную форму кладешь кнопку и в ее событие клика пишешь такой код (допустим поле первичного ключа у тебя в таблице называется ID, имя основной формы=Form1, а подчиненной Form2):
DoCmd.OpenForm 'Form2', ,'ID=' & _
Me![ID], acFormReadOnly
Т.е. жмешь на кнопку и открывается форма с дополнительной инфой по записи которая сейчас является текущей в основной форме.

2. Через механизм подчиненных форм
В главную форму вставляешь подчиненную (Form2) и в свойстах Master Fields(основные поля) и Chield Fields(подчиненные поля) подчиненной фoрмы указываешь поле связи ID.
Теперь когда ты будешь просматривать записи в форме в области подчиненной формы будет отображаться дополнительная инфа по этой записи.

А поля с сумами , со средними значениями и значениями каждого показателя во второй форме делаешь с помощью вычисляемых полей, т.е. полей у которых в свойстве DataSource(Данные) стоит не имя поля базового источника данных для формы а выражение начинающееся со знака равенства например:
=[Param]*2 + ([Param]/10 + 64)
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
inter-admin
Эксперт
29715 / 6470 / 2152
Регистрация: 06.03.2009
Сообщений: 28,500
Блог
21.05.2007, 08:28
Помогаю со студенческими работами здесь

Задача по MS access
Здравствуйте, задание такое: Создать БД Шахм.атный тур.нир; да.та и вр.емя пар.тии; пер.вый игр.ок пар.тии; вто.рой игр.ок; побе.дитель...

Задача в Access
Здравствуйте, помогите, пожалуйста сделайте задач. :help: Пользователь вводит с клавиатуры срока символов. Удалить из срока все...

задача по Access?
Срочно нужно !!!!

Задача по Access
Сам не могу сделать помогите Имеются три таблицы: 1. перечень услуг клиники: код процедуры, наименование, цена процедуры 2. о...

задача в MC Access
Ребят, помогите пожалуйста с задачей, завтра курсач по ней сдавать Структурно предприятие состоит из цехов, которые в свою очередь...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
3
Ответ Создать тему
Опции темы

Новые блоги и статьи
Автозаполнение реквизита при выборе элемента справочника
Maks 27.03.2026
Программный код из решения ниже на примере нетипового документа "ЗаявкаНаРемонтСпецтехники" разработанного в конфигурации КА2. При выборе "Спецтехники" (Тип Справочник. Спецтехника), заполняется. . .
Сумматор с применением элементов трёх состояний.
Hrethgir 26.03.2026
Тут. https:/ / fips. ru/ EGD/ ab3c85c8-836d-4866-871b-c2f0c5d77fbc Первый документ красиво выглядит, но без схемы. Это конечно не даёт никаких плюсов автору, но тем не менее. . . всё может быть. . .
Автозаполнение реквизитов при создании документа
Maks 26.03.2026
Программный код из решения ниже размещается в модуле объекта документа, в процедуре "ПриСозданииНаСервере". Алгоритм проверки заполнения реализован для исключения перезаписи значения реквизита,. . .
Команды формы и диалоговое окно
Maks 26.03.2026
1. Команда формы "ЗаполнитьЗапчасти". Программный код из решения ниже на примере нетипового документа "ЗаявкаНаРемонтСпецтехники" разработанного в конфигурации КА2. В качестве источника данных. . .
Кому нужен AOT?
DevAlt 26.03.2026
Решил сделать простой ланчер Написал заготовку: dotnet new console --aot -o UrlHandler var items = args. Split(":"); var tag = items; var id = items; var executable = args;. . .
Отправка уведомления на почту при изменении наименования справочника
Maks 24.03.2026
Программная отправка письма электронной почты на примере изменения наименования типового справочника "Склады" в конфигурации БП3. Перед реализацией необходимо выполнить настройку системной учетной. . .
модель ЗдравоСохранения 5. Меньше увольнений- больше дохода!
anaschu 24.03.2026
Теперь система здравосохранения уменьшает количество увольнений. 9TO2GP2bpX4 a42b81fb172ffc12ca589c7898261ccb/ https:/ / rutube. ru/ video/ a42b81fb172ffc12ca589c7898261ccb/ Слева синяя линия -. . .
Midnight Chicago Blues
kumehtar 24.03.2026
Такой Midnight Chicago Blues, знаешь?. . Когда вечерние улицы становятся ночными, а ты не можешь уснуть. Ты идёшь в любимый старый бар, и бармен наливает тебе виски. Ты смотришь на пролетающие. . .
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2026, CyberForum.ru